In today's digital age, accessing a vast array of books without leaving the comfort of your home has never been easier. Whether you're a voracious reader on the hunt for classics or someone seeking to discover new genres without spending a dime, the internet offers numerous resources for free eBooks. From well-known platforms like Amazon to gems like Project Gutenberg and Libby, this article explores the top websites where you can download or read eBooks at no cost, ensuring your reading list is always full.
Amazon
As a major player in eBook distribution, Amazon offers an effective way to discover free books, particularly for Kindle owners. Although it's challenging to find free books directly via the Kindle device, the Amazon website hosts a section called "Top 100 Free" under the Best Sellers list. On the Amazon app, typing "free books" in the search might also bring up several options, though be aware that in-app purchases are restricted. Moreover, Amazon features services like Kindle Unlimited and Prime Reading, which provide access to a vast library of books at no extra cost to subscribers—note, however, that these services require a paid subscription themselves. Project Gutenberg
Project Gutenberg, launched in 1971, is the oldest digital library with a collection that includes over 70,000 titles, primarily of classic literature. The site supports multiple formats suitable for various e-readers, including Kindle. Google Play Books
Google Play Books offers a solid alternative to Amazon's Kindle service, featuring a considerable selection of free eBooks. Users can find these by navigating to the eBook charts on the Google Play Books app and selecting the Free category. Libby
Libby, which takes over from OverDrive, provides access to borrow eBooks from local libraries using a library card. It is especially convenient for Kindle users in the U.S. as it integrates well with these devices. Open Library
As part of the Internet Archive, Open Library offers easier access to a wide variety of books, including notable titles available for borrowing. eBooks.com
Although primarily a commercial site, eBooks.com offers around 400 free eBooks that can be read online or downloaded, subject to DRM restrictions.
